    About Habibata

    Habibata, a name rich with the warmth of its Arabic roots, meaning "beloved" or "darling," offers a soft and gentle sound that feels both exotic and deeply affectionate. This contemporary choice is perfect for parents seeking a name that carries a beautiful, universally cherished meaning, while also standing out with its melodic rhythm. Particularly popular in West African nations like Mali and Senegal, Habibata transcends a purely Western aesthetic, offering a connection to a broader cultural tapestry. Unlike many gentle names, Habibata possesses a distinctive, flowing cadence that makes it memorable and unique, rather than simply pretty. It's a name that embraces love and tenderness with an understated elegance.
